Indian officer burnt to death in property dispute



AGENCIES: A revenue official has been burnt alive in her office in the southern Indian state of Telangana over a property dispute, police said.

Vijaya Reddy died from her injuries at the scene of the attack on Monday. One of her staff, who was burnt while trying to save her, died on Tuesday.

A graphic video of the incident shows Reddy crying for help before someone throws a blanket over her.

Police said they had detained the accused, who also suffered burns.

The incident occurred around 13:30 local time after Reddy had returned from a court hearing. She was meeting a man, who police have identified as K Suresh, in her office.

Two staff members – Chandriah and Gurunatham – also suffered burns while trying to rescue Reddy.

Gurunnatham said he heard screams from inside Reddy’s office but found that the door was locked from inside.
